Skip to content

Commit e37178a

Browse files
committed
Update IterableApi.java
1 parent 3ccee65 commit e37178a

File tree

1 file changed

+4
-5
lines changed

1 file changed

+4
-5
lines changed

iterableapi/src/main/java/com/iterable/iterableapi/IterableApi.java

Lines changed: 4 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-870,7 +870,7 @@ public void inAppConsume(@NonNull String messageId) {
870870
*/
871871
public void inAppConsume(@NonNull String messageId, @Nullable IterableHelper.SuccessHandler successHandler, @Nullable IterableHelper.FailureHandler failureHandler) {
872872
IterableInAppMessage message = getInAppManager().getMessageById(messageId);
873-
if (handleNullMessage(message, failureHandler)) {
873+
if (checkIfMessageIsNull(message, failureHandler)) {
874874
return;
875875
}
876876
inAppConsume(message, null, null, successHandler, failureHandler);
@@ -890,8 +890,7 @@ public void inAppConsume(@NonNull IterableInAppMessage message, @Nullable Iterab
890890
if (!checkSDKInitialization()) {
891891
return;
892892
}
893-
if (message == null) {
894-
IterableLogger.e(TAG, "inAppConsume: message is null");
893+
if (checkIfMessageIsNull(message, null)) {
895894
return;
896895
}
897896
apiClient.inAppConsume(message, source, clickLocation, inboxSessionId, null, null);
@@ -912,7 +911,7 @@ public void inAppConsume(@NonNull IterableInAppMessage message, @Nullable Iterab
912911
if (!checkSDKInitialization()) {
913912
return;
914913
}
915-
if (handleNullMessage(message, failureHandler)) {
914+
if (checkIfMessageIsNull(message, failureHandler)) {
916915
return;
917916
}
918917
apiClient.inAppConsume(message, source, clickLocation, inboxSessionId, successHandler, failureHandler);
@@ -926,7 +925,7 @@ public void inAppConsume(@NonNull IterableInAppMessage message, @Nullable Iterab
926925
* @param failureHandler The failure handler to be called if the message is null.
927926
* @return True if the message is null, false otherwise.
928927
*/
929-
private boolean handleNullMessage(@Nullable IterableInAppMessage message, @Nullable IterableHelper.FailureHandler failureHandler) {
928+
private boolean checkIfMessageIsNull(@Nullable IterableInAppMessage message, @Nullable IterableHelper.FailureHandler failureHandler) {
930929
if (message == null) {
931930
IterableLogger.e(TAG, "inAppConsume: message is null");
932931
if (failureHandler != null) {

0 commit comments

Comments
 (0)